About Bank Ganesha Tbk

P.T. Bank Ganesha Tbk (”the Bank”) was established based on Deed No. 47 dated May 15, 1990 of notary Esther Daniar Iskandar S.H. The Bank started commercial operations on April 30, 1992 when it obtained its business license based on the Decision Letter No. 393/KMK-013/1992 dated April 14, 1992 from the Minister of Finance of the Republic of Indonesia. In accordance with Bank Indonesia’sDecision Letter No. 26/66/KEP/DIR dated September 12, 1995, the Bank is authorized to be a foreign exchange bank.

About Bumi Resources Minerals Tbk

PT Bumi Resources Mineral (the company) was established under its original name of PT Panorama Timur Abadi base on notarial deed No.3 of Mr Safrudin, S.H, dated on 6 Aug, 2003. The Company’s articles of association has been amended several times, most recently by notarial deed No.102 of Humberg Lie, S.H., dated Jun 22, 2010, concerning among others, change the name of the company the composition of the Board of Directors and Commissioners, and public offering.
